The Experience
Your day begins in Arusha town, where you set off on a scenic drive toward Themi Valley at the foothills of Mount Meru. As you approach the trailhead, the sound of rushing water grows louder, and the air becomes cooler and fresher.
The hike to Napuru Waterfall is moderately challenging, taking you along narrow forest paths lined with wildflowers, banana groves, and small farms tended by local villagers. Along the way, you may meet friendly locals carrying firewood or tending to livestock — offering a glimpse into the everyday rhythm of rural Tanzanian life.
When you finally reach the waterfall, the view is nothing short of mesmerizing — a powerful stream plunging into a clear natural pool, surrounded by mossy rocks and misty spray. Many visitors choose to take a refreshing dip or simply sit back, breathe, and enjoy the cool breeze and gentle roar of the falls.
After spending some peaceful time at the site, you’ll hike back through the forest, perhaps stopping for a local lunch or cultural visit in the nearby villages before returning to Arusha.

Best Time to Visit
Napuru Waterfall is accessible year-round, but it’s most spectacular during the green season (November–May) when the water flow is strongest and the surrounding vegetation is at its most vibrant.
